215. To ask the Minister for Agriculture, Food and the Marine if a representative of an organisation (details supplied) will be included on the EU monitoring committee for the Rural Development Programme;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[20229/18]
Michael Creed (Cork North West,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source
The Monitoring Committee for Ireland’s Rural Development Programme (RDP) 2014–2020 was set up in accordance with Article 47 of (EU) Regulation 1303/2015, which requires that it be in place within three months of the Commission decision to adopt the new RDP. The Monitoring Committee was therefore formed in July 2015, following a comprehensive selection process. The aim of that process was to ensure that the relevant public authorities, economic and social partners and civil society were involved in the implementation and monitoring of the Irish RDP through active participation in the Committee.
While I am satisfied that the Committee is successfully carrying out its function with the present composition of the Committee, the question of extending the representation to the organisation in question is a live issue. I have met with representatives of the organisation and they subsequently provided detailed additional information, which is being considered by officials in my Department.
